Aussie Flight Bans – Airlines warn that Europe-bound flights from Australia could be delayed up to a week by the vast cloud of volcanic ash blanketing most of the continent.

Qantas says passengers should prepare for significant disruption with the volcanic eruption in Iceland grounding flights across Europe in the biggest air travel shutdown since World War II.

“At this stage it’s highly unlikely things are going to return to normal for several days at least, and it may well be a week,” Qantas spokesman David Epstein said today.

Later the airline announced the cancellation of all inbound and outbound services to Britain and Europe scheduled for tomorrow – the third consecutive day of disruptions.

However, the airline said some services between Asian destinations and Australia including Hong Kong, Bangkok and Singapore will continue to operate.
